Windows系统日志满:原因分析、解决方法及预防策略340
Windows操作系统依赖于各种日志文件来记录系统事件、应用程序活动以及安全审计信息。这些日志对于诊断问题、追踪安全事件和监控系统性能至关重要。然而,如果系统日志空间已满,则会严重影响系统的稳定性和安全性。本文将深入探讨Windows系统日志已满的原因、有效的解决方法以及预防策略,帮助系统管理员和用户有效地管理和维护系统日志。
一、 Windows系统日志满的原因分析
Windows系统日志满通常源于以下几个主要原因:
日志文件大小限制未设置或设置过小:默认情况下,Windows系统日志文件的大小是有限制的。如果日志文件达到预设大小限制,新的事件将无法写入,导致日志服务停止或系统出现警告。 这可能是由于初始配置不当或系统长时间运行导致日志文件逐渐增大而未及时调整。
大量错误或警告事件:系统错误、应用程序故障以及安全事件都会生成大量的日志条目。如果系统频繁出现错误或警告,日志文件将会迅速填满。这可能由硬件故障、软件冲突、病毒攻击或恶意软件活动引起。
系统资源不足:磁盘空间不足是另一个导致日志满的重要因素。当系统磁盘空间接近满负荷时,所有程序,包括日志服务,都将难以正常运行,从而导致日志文件无法写入新的事件。
日志清除机制失效:Windows系统提供日志轮换和自动清除机制,可以定期删除旧的日志文件以腾出空间。如果此机制失效,例如由于系统配置错误或服务故障,日志文件将会持续增长直到磁盘空间耗尽。
恶意软件活动:某些恶意软件会故意生成大量的日志条目来掩盖其活动痕迹,或者利用日志服务进行拒绝服务攻击(DoS),从而导致系统日志空间迅速耗尽。
应用程序错误:某些应用程序可能存在bug,导致它们持续写入大量冗余或无用信息到系统日志,最终导致日志空间被占用。
二、 解决Windows系统日志已满的方法
当遇到Windows系统日志已满的情况时,需要采取以下措施来解决问题:
检查磁盘空间:首先确认系统磁盘空间是否充足。如果磁盘空间不足,需要删除不必要的旧文件或将文件转移到其他存储设备,释放磁盘空间。
清除旧日志文件:可以使用Windows自带的事件查看器来清除旧的日志文件。 可以根据需要选择清除特定日志(例如应用程序日志、系统日志或安全日志)或清除所有日志。 需要注意的是,清除日志可能会导致丢失重要的事件记录,因此在清除之前,建议备份重要的日志文件。
配置日志文件大小限制:可以通过修改注册表或使用PowerShell脚本来调整系统日志文件的大小限制。 这可以防止日志文件再次迅速填满。 建议设置一个合理的大小限制,并定期检查日志文件的大小。
配置日志轮换策略:可以配置系统日志的轮换策略,例如设置日志文件最大大小和存档策略。 当日志文件达到最大大小时,系统会自动创建新的日志文件并存档旧的日志文件,防止日志文件无限增长。
检查系统事件:仔细检查系统日志中记录的事件,找出导致日志文件迅速增长的根本原因。 这可能需要分析系统错误日志、应用程序日志和安全日志,从而找出并解决潜在的软件或硬件问题。
运行病毒扫描:如果怀疑是恶意软件导致日志空间耗尽,需要运行全盘病毒扫描来清除潜在的恶意软件。
重启系统:在某些情况下,重启系统可以清除某些临时日志文件,释放一部分磁盘空间,从而解决日志满的问题。
三、 预防Windows系统日志已满的策略
为了预防Windows系统日志再次被填满,可以采取以下预防策略:
定期监控日志文件大小:定期检查系统日志文件的大小,并及时调整日志文件大小限制或清除旧的日志文件。
设置合理的日志轮换策略:配置合理的日志轮换策略,确保系统日志文件能够自动管理,避免无限增长。
优化系统性能:通过优化系统性能,减少系统错误和警告事件的发生,从而减少日志文件的大小。
定期备份日志文件:定期备份重要的日志文件,以便在需要时能够恢复这些日志信息。
安装和使用可靠的软件:尽量安装和使用可靠的软件,以减少应用程序错误的发生,避免生成过多的日志条目。
及时更新系统和软件:定期更新操作系统和软件,可以修复已知的漏洞和bug,降低系统错误的发生概率。
加强系统安全:加强系统安全,可以有效预防病毒攻击和恶意软件入侵,避免这些因素导致日志空间耗尽。
总结:Windows系统日志已满是一个需要认真对待的问题。通过理解其根本原因,并采取相应的解决方法和预防策略,可以有效地维护系统的稳定性和安全性,保证系统的正常运行。
2025-03-14
新文章

国产桌面Linux系统:技术挑战与发展机遇

Linux系统安装深度解析:从准备工作到系统优化

Windows系统内核文件详解:架构、功能与安全

Linux与Windows系统互联互通详解:协议、工具及安全考虑

彻底清除Windows系统冗余文件:方法、风险与最佳实践

华为鸿蒙系统维修模式详解:内核、文件系统与故障诊断

iOS系统深度解析:性能、安全与生态的博弈

Android系统时间获取及JavaScript桥接机制详解

RAID配置下Windows系统的安装与高级技巧

华为平板适配鸿蒙HarmonyOS:深度剖析底层技术及适配挑战
热门文章

iOS 系统的局限性

Mac OS 9:革命性操作系统的深度剖析

macOS 直接安装新系统,保留原有数据

Linux USB 设备文件系统

华为鸿蒙操作系统:业界领先的分布式操作系统

**三星 One UI 与华为 HarmonyOS 操作系统:详尽对比**

iOS 操作系统:移动领域的先驱

华为鸿蒙系统:全面赋能多场景智慧体验
![macOS 系统语言更改指南 [专家详解]](https://cdn.shapao.cn/1/1/f6cabc75abf1ff05.png)
macOS 系统语言更改指南 [专家详解]
